Renai Kouhosei Starlight Scramble is a 1998 PlayStation simulator that blends sci-fi management with narrative-driven gameplay. Set in a futuristic satellite colony called Second One's Home, players navigate a world where political tensions, mysterious disappearances, and extraterrestrial encounters collide. The game follows a cast of characters dealing with both cosmic threats and personal relationships, requiring players to balance colony operations with story progression. Decision-making impacts outcomes as you manage resources, investigate incidents, and interact with a cast shaped by both human drama and interstellar mystery. The game stands out for its ambitious mix of strategic simulation and serialized storytelling, uncommon for its time. With a runtime spanning years of in-game events and branching scenarios tied to real-time choices, it offers depth rarely seen in 90s simulators. While its complex narrative and management systems may feel dated, fans of niche sci-fi simulations appreciate its bold attempt to merge macro-scale governance with intimate character arcs. Its PlayStation-era charm and layered plotting keep it a curiosity for retro gaming enthusiasts.
